Output c76910d180956ebc5d76d34c717ed80d39db318265c2b02f30a3da8402b08d4e:0

value
258535388
script pubkey
OP_0 OP_PUSHBYTES_20 bb7af5ddff6edac53d2a91e08fb05dd5a957479e
address
bc1qhda0th0ldmdv20f2j8sglvza6k54w3u76dxz0x
transaction
c76910d180956ebc5d76d34c717ed80d39db318265c2b02f30a3da8402b08d4e
confirmations
127121
spent
true